While short-haired dogs generally shed less than their long-haired counterparts, shedding can vary among breeds. Many short-haired breeds experience minimal shedding, making them more suitable for individuals with allergies or those seeking lower maintenance. However, the extent of shedding can still depend on factors like genetics, health, and seasonal changes.

You might say that Australian Kelpies have a Type A personality. They are incredibly energetic, highly intelligent, and total workaholics. “Their energy and drive are boundless, and they need mental and physical stimulation to keep them out of trouble,” advises Dr. Cruz. Kelpies were bred to herd livestock, so they tend to “herd” small pets and children by nipping their feet. That’s not to say this medium short-haired dog won’t fit into an urban family home, but Kelpies need to “work” every day. In terms of grooming, their double coat is weather-repellent.
